U.S. Marines with Battalion Landing Team 1/1, 31st Marine Expeditionary Unit, wrap detonating cord in duct tape during an urban sustainment training exercise on Camp Hansen, Okinawa, Japan, Jan. 5, 2024. Combat engineers attached to BLT 1/1 taught Marines proper procedures for making and employing breaching charges in urban environments. The 31st MEU, the Marine Corps’ only continuously forward-deployed MEU, provides a flexible and lethal force ready to perform a wide range of military operations as the premiere crisis response force in the Indo-Pacific region.
